Memorial Day Murph Challenge Workout 2021 | Cali BBQ Official Host Location

READY. SET. MURPH! The Murph Challenge co-founder Michael Sauers shared tips with us for conquering the intense Murph Challenge workout for Memorial Day. The Murph Challenge workout is: 1 Mile Run, 100 Pull-ups, 200 Push-ups, 300 Squats, and a 1 Mile Run. For an even greater challenge, you can do the workout in a 20lb weighted […]
